di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2017-10-09 18:53:29 +0100 |
commit | 4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ch) | |
tree | ba5f07bf3f9d22d82e54a462313f5d244036c768 /app-arch/pure-sfv |
reinit the tree, so we can have metadata
Diffstat (limited to 'app-arch/pure-sfv')
-rw-r--r-- | app-arch/pure-sfv/Manifest | 6 | ||||
-rw-r--r-- | app-arch/pure-sfv/files/pure-sfv-0.3-asneeded.patch | 11 | ||||
-rw-r--r-- | app-arch/pure-sfv/metadata.xml | 8 | ||||
-rw-r--r-- | app-arch/pure-sfv/pure-sfv-0.3-r1.ebuild | 34 |
4 files changed, 59 insertions, 0 deletions
diff --git a/app-arch/pure-sfv/Manifest b/app-arch/pure-sfv/Manifest new file mode 100644 index 000000000000..4224f9977238 --- /dev/null +++ b/app-arch/pure-sfv/Manifest @@ -0,0 +1,6 @@ +AUX pure-sfv-0.3-asneeded.patch 392 SHA256 82be727f05017bdbc1ed31c2986b96c66f70216ee9459bf215b57103d9d26427 SHA512 74ce8a8628e2d0571556301ac8d0ec46ad7f9da50fe515197eb6ba81d9a7b41da1f4886e6d7b7fe6e411688bfec00296ce2f18c742d224e80bf1a8b614a0672a WHIRLPOOL 287a63b7ff1fcafcdb48c4b9952c6b2dafe4ddeadb0380b6b66d64edf03e468e30caacadcc4dba40d86a0dc9e657f89d6679de87aa79f898065ec023a8e66a09 +DIST pure-sfv_0.3_src.tar.gz 79069 SHA256 b5dc97e96656dbe397439c85b0b8ecebddd9d350a09a7485c653ff9210989321 SHA512 defacdaa0b78f708c83198e911ad93a5c5456bf15e2b33df61c984241df8a82ff4d962b8c7994c6413b36a61df2cc6d91c467bf8994fa43e0ac01db2585a78a6 WHIRLPOOL 2befa4d4dd6e0e043e50ca4b69e0024c71c68483af52ffe13bbac569d6f9482d5d167e25e918ddf314cf950e88e7271813c05fd2d1e0177ac6177a619ed7451e +EBUILD pure-sfv-0.3-r1.ebuild 681 SHA256 6ee36431fcfe0ca132ab82031f872aabaae0b632417de85e5a0959b863d0e124 SHA512 ffc5d677fe40682bf744968c1ec7b21633c888f470eb0efaeefc2888d398d102f332e80587254a77693d9e5ee27e1aa9fb8fd7ded63d64fb1e0453c8fc867e0e WHIRLPOOL 75d74260b672c99e440621b53d82453566aab520c7ff332c57936dd8e738a82dc208e0fdd86ab8722fd6b7bac25947eecb952e50c15666c8373b8761d6805103 +MISC ChangeLog 2563 SHA256 78d8d0e79a40bc2324c5a8f39c091c8ee074d7f6b95292618926192ac1a6ed64 SHA512 fb63e833d91568727467efb3347ae5ed3f487dcd02fd1782eac0edd672b05993114d21788f2c10414c0bca5ae9f1f2fecc910351ea39ecc98e1afc1e009de5aa WHIRLPOOL 86c14c7f60e17f42f813486a05446f89b349cbebf5048d4a73ffc6ed3d5081f21e3856fed714ecc1e6e505075fc3c5e87792d8ece5c8dde5f6460ecb3f4f581f +MISC ChangeLog-2015 2196 SHA256 fdaa6c3bdac2ea62a3160d8d06b1d01c919b6ba741f5c0b68714b8e2731c3268 SHA512 bd7b357d1b019977a6a4f0b34faf3eb793034940edaf98e24e8cf347f4e600758497ba43424f298ac66e601777cf594f93efaa4a914a1cf38cb7a11c5b0e6e71 WHIRLPOOL ff5f5d2f81245a1c6b439508a53791ac3dc09f3d1896119ddf80045e2bd29748fe326e83afb15da0b7543d4bb2e7e998061652699da5913e59d0ca2bd760654f +MISC metadata.xml 245 SHA256 a34d08ca4f199ddfc5d08224d97ee1e2c0e81cea401f873302d9252e0d823830 SHA512 4423c18a453e8c9b251ccc387341ffa1e1f492c2b0408d05b3948b94fd8f135145740bb9a04862d5f567c931c50c113f685a08fb10667ed1fcd1a005cbbe46da WHIRLPOOL 8259f19d9eb082f0121e29ec2395ed6cf20af942ee992036b805734c67ea4ba72d4d4346770f1f1351cf6d2192aafb7d080d9eda128772eab68d4a76ee59e183 diff --git a/app-arch/pure-sfv/files/pure-sfv-0.3-asneeded.patch b/app-arch/pure-sfv/files/pure-sfv-0.3-asneeded.patch new file mode 100644 index 000000000000..926dd1318bdc --- /dev/null +++ b/app-arch/pure-sfv/files/pure-sfv-0.3-asneeded.patch @@ -0,0 +1,11 @@ +--- Makefile.orig 2009-01-03 18:36:24.349399478 +0100 ++++ Makefile 2009-01-03 18:36:37.218398964 +0100 +@@ -65,7 +65,7 @@ + OBJ = ${SRCS:%.c=%.o} + + pure-sfv: $(OBJ) +- $(CC) -lm -DVERSION=\"$(VERSION)\" $(CFLAGS) -o $(PROG) $(OBJ) ++ $(CC) -DVERSION=\"$(VERSION)\" $(CFLAGS) $(LDFLAGS) -o $(PROG) $(OBJ) -lm + + PURIFY_OPTIONS=-follow-child-processes=yes -always-use-cache-dir=yes + PURIFY=purify diff --git a/app-arch/pure-sfv/metadata.xml b/app-arch/pure-sfv/metadata.xml new file mode 100644 index 000000000000..e48e0f140627 --- /dev/null +++ b/app-arch/pure-sfv/metadata.xml @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<!-- maintainer-needed --> + <upstream> + <remote-id type="sourceforge">pure-sfv</remote-id> + </upstream> +</pkgmetadata> diff --git a/app-arch/pure-sfv/pure-sfv-0.3-r1.ebuild b/app-arch/pure-sfv/pure-sfv-0.3-r1.ebuild new file mode 100644 index 000000000000..ca26b16fbcfb --- /dev/null +++ b/app-arch/pure-sfv/pure-sfv-0.3-r1.ebuild @@ -0,0 +1,34 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I="2" + +inherit eutils toolchain-funcs + +DESCRIPTION="utility to test and create .sfv files and create .par files" +HOMEPAGE="http://pure-sfv.sourceforge.net/" +SRC_URI="mirror://sourceforge/pure-sfv/${PN}_${PV}_src.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="amd64 ~hppa ppc x86" +IUSE="" +RESTRICT="test" + +DEPEND="" + +S="${WORKDIR}" + +src_prepare() { + sed -i Makefile -e "s:-Werror -O2 -g::" + epatch "${FILESDIR}"/${P}-asneeded.patch +} + +src_compile() { + emake CC="$(tc-getCC)" || die "emake failed" +} + +src_install() { + dobin pure-sfv || die "dobin failed" + dodoc ReadMe.txt +} |